Unveiling the Potential of Commercial Property Investment


India's burgeoning economy, coupled with a rapidly urbanizing population, has propelled the commercial real estate sector into the limelight. As businesses expand and the demand for office spaces, retail outlets, and industrial facilities grows, savvy investors are turning their attention to commercial property investment. This blog aims to explore the unique aspects of commercial property investment in India, highlighting the opportunities, challenges, and strategies for success in this dynamic market.

The Indian Commercial Real Estate Landscape

India's commercial real estate market is characterized by its diversity, with each city offering distinct advantages. Mumbai and Delhi-NCR are traditional powerhouses, boasting prime office spaces and high-end retail locations. Bangalore and Hyderabad, known as India's Silicon Valleys, are hubs for tech companies and startups, driving demand for office spaces in these regions. Chennai, Pune, and Kolkata also present lucrative opportunities, with growing industrial and IT sectors.

Opportunities in Commercial Property Investment

  1. Economic Growth: India's GDP growth rate, one of the highest among major economies, fuels business expansion and increases the demand for commercial spaces.
  2. Favorable Policies: The government's initiatives, such as "Make in India" and "Smart Cities Mission," are creating a conducive environment for commercial investments.
  3. Rising Demand: The increasing number of startups and the expansion of existing businesses necessitate more office and retail spaces.
  4. High Rental Yields: Commercial properties in India often offer higher rental yields compared to residential properties, making them attractive for investors seeking regular income.

Challenges in Commercial Property Investment

  1. High Initial Investment: Commercial properties require a significant upfront investment, which can be a barrier for some investors.
  2. Market Volatility: Economic fluctuations and changes in business trends can impact the demand for commercial spaces.
  3. Regulatory Hurdles: Navigating the complex regulatory environment, including land acquisition laws and rental agreements, can be challenging.
  4. Property Management: Effective management of commercial properties requires expertise in tenant relations, maintenance, and operational efficiency.

Strategies for Successful Commercial Property Investment

  1. Market Research: Conduct thorough research to identify high-growth areas and understand tenant demand.
  2. Diversification: Spread investments across different types of commercial properties and locations to mitigate risks.
  3. Professional Management: Consider hiring professional property management firms to handle day-to-day operations and tenant relations.
  4. Long-Term Perspective: Commercial property investment is typically a long-term commitment. Patience and a strategic outlook are key to realizing substantial returns.

Commercial property investment in India presents a wealth of opportunities for investors willing to navigate the complexities of the market. With careful planning, research, and a strategic approach, investors can capitalize on the growing demand for commercial spaces and achieve significant returns on their investments. As India continues to emerge as a global economic powerhouse, the commercial real estate sector is poised for robust growth, making it an exciting avenue for investment.
